The copyright Gold Rush: Mining in the Anthropocene

Wiki Article

Deep within server farms and sprawling data centers, a new gold rush is underway. Bitcoin, the revolutionary copyright, has ignited a global frenzy for its limited supply, driving miners to battle for the right to create new coins. The race for these digital riches comes with an environmental burden, as the energy required to solve complex cryptographic problems consumes vast amounts of electricity. This insatiable appetite for power raises serious questions about Bitcoin's sustainability in an era where climate change threatens our planet.
